The term “virgin” is applied to virgin olive oil since The International Olive Oil Council clearly defined what a virgin olive oil is and in what manner it may be produced.
Coconut oil in its purest form is water-white in color, with distinct coconut flavor and aroma and with free fatty acid content ranging from 0.05 0.08 % (as oleic) without undergoing the chemical refining process. However, this type of oil is not readily available in the commercial market. The common color of coconut oil is yellow.
